Understand the Unemployment Insurance Policy

Understand the Unemployment Insurance Policy


The state of the nation's economy has left thousands of people without a job. In fact, the unemployment rates have reached an all time high in many regions. These individuals are left with no source of income to pay their monthly obligations or purchase food for their families. However, for many individuals there is a source of help for these financial difficulties.

Unemployment insurance benefits are available to a large majority of people that find themselves unemployed. These benefits are available to individuals who find themselves out of work due to reasons that are beyond their control. People who quit their job, for any reason, are not eligible for this compensation. Individuals who were fired for cause are also ineligible for this benefit. The majority of individuals who find themselves applying for these benefits were laid off due to lack of work.

Each state has its own fund to pay these benefits to eligible people. The majority of the states require employers to pay certain taxes to support this fund. However, there are a few states that require individuals to pay taxes to help fund this program. These programs are all regulated by certain federal laws.

The individual state also has certain procedures that must be completed prior to an individual being approved for these benefits. The individual must first fill out the necessary paperwork. This paperwork must be submitted to the proper unemployment agency in their local area. Any individual who does not fill out the paperwork correctly, or meet the requirements, will often find themselves denied for benefits.

There is typically a waiting period that must lapse before an individual begins receiving these payments. The waiting period is usually a short amount of time, such as a week or two. However, many states that have a large amount of people filing claims may have longer waiting periods.

The beneficiary of these benefits will begin receiving payments once the waiting period is over. These benefits are typically paid on a weekly or biweekly basis. Recipients of unemployment insurance benefits are required to do several things while receiving these funds. The individual must be actively looking for employment. They must report any job offers they have received. The person must also claim any money they have earned. This money can be from any source where services were provided.

Most states only allow an individual to receive these benefits for a period of twenty-six weeks. However, many people have been able to continue receiving these benefits after the initial period is over. This is especially true when unemployment rates are extremely high. Extending the amount of time a person receives these funds is done by filing an extension.

Unemployment insurance is a temporary source of income for thousands of people who have lost their jobs. This income comes from the state the person was working in. Benefits received must be reported on the individual's income taxes for the year the income was received.
